Hydrophobic coating

Hydrophobic coatings are able to get rid of dirt and spots from surfaces such as metal, glass, and plastic. They also protect surfaces from water damage and enhance the durability of these surfaces. They are often used on outdoor surfaces, and they can help reduce the cost of cleaning and also time. They can also aid in preventing rust and corrosion and provide UV protection.

Hydrophobic paints are smooth surfaces that repel water molecules. These coatings are usually made from fluoropolymers, including pol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), better known as Teflon. These substances have a high lubricity and a slippery feel. They can be used on metals, glass, and textiles. The manufacturers determine the hydrophobicity of a material by placing a droplet of the substance on its surface and observing the contact angle. Coatings with a contact angle of 150 degrees or more are referred to as super-hydrophobic.

Safe windows

While much of the security market is focused on doors, burglars can gain entry to homes through windows too. Two out of three burglaries that occur in America involve a window.

There are plenty of ways to make your windows more secure. For instance, you can install window bars, which stop burglars from entering your home through the windows and are available in a variety. They are a great way to keep your privacy and not hinder your view.

Installing tempered glass is another option. It is more durable and secure than regular annealed glasses. When glass that is tempered breaks and shatter, they break into smaller, relatively safe pieces instead of sharp and dangerous shreds. This type of glass can also reduce the risk of injury when broken windows are present, especially in the event of a natural disaster or break-in.

Full frame replacement can be more expensive than insert replacement, however it's generally worth the cost. The process involves removing the exterior and interior trim, as well as the installation of the new window. This permits for thorough inspections and repairs, which can reduce the risk of moisture intrusion that could have developed over time in the window that was previously installed.
